In Korea these rosy hued rice balls are served as a snack. Mixed with dates, pine nuts and chestnuts, the chewy rice is transformed into something naturally sweet and nutritious. You can make the rice mixture into balls to eat as snack, or serve it hot in a bowl as a side dish with roast pork, chicken or turkey. This dish takes planning ahead as you must soak the rice for 5 hours. To freeze and reheat portions of the rice mixture, see “Rice Anytime”.<
